About CrossWorld AI
CrossWorld AI is a conversational AI platform that lets users engage in immersive roleplay with characters from anime, video games, and original universes. Powered by large language models, it blends interactive storytelling with real-time chat. The platform is designed for fans of fictional worlds who want to explore cross-universe interactions and original narratives. Its key differentiator is the seamless fusion of multiple fictional realms into a single chat experience, allowing characters from different settings to coexist and interact. Users can create custom scenarios, chat with pre-made characters, or let AI generate dynamic storylines. The service is entirely web-based, accessible from any modern browser.
Behind the Verdict
CrossWorld AI is an intriguing entry in the niche of AI roleplay. Its multiverse concept is novel and executed with decent LLM integration. However, the lack of transparent pricing, API access, or community features limits its appeal to hardcore fans. For casual users wanting to chat with fictional characters, it's a fun diversion. But power users or developers will find it lacking. The platform is best approached as a creative toy rather than a serious tool. We recommend it if you're curious about cross-over character interactions, but set expectations accordingly — it's not a comprehensive chatbot ecosystem.
